Accomplice Liability is the seventeenth episode of the twenty-sixth season of Law & Order: Special Victims Unit, and the five hundred sixty-seventh episode overall.

Plot Overview
Carisi attempts to put aside his role as prosecutor to serve as a witness in a trial. Benson tries to help a rape survivor struggling with her recovery.
